Mercurial > pub > ImplabNet
comparison Implab.Test/JsonTests.cs @ 265:74e048cbaac8 v3 v3.0.10
Restored lost JsonXmlCaseTransform from version 2.1
author | cin |
---|---|
date | Mon, 16 Apr 2018 19:43:18 +0300 |
parents | 3a6e18c432be |
children |
comparison
equal
deleted
inserted
replaced
264:3a6e18c432be | 265:74e048cbaac8 |
---|---|
165 using (var xmlWriter = XmlWriter.Create(Console.Out, new XmlWriterSettings { | 165 using (var xmlWriter = XmlWriter.Create(Console.Out, new XmlWriterSettings { |
166 Indent = true, | 166 Indent = true, |
167 CloseOutput = false, | 167 CloseOutput = false, |
168 ConformanceLevel = ConformanceLevel.Document | 168 ConformanceLevel = ConformanceLevel.Document |
169 })) | 169 })) |
170 using (var xmlReader = new JsonXmlReader(JsonReader.ParseString(json), new JsonXmlReaderOptions { NamespaceUri = "JsonXmlReaderSimpleTest", NodesPrefix = "json" })) { | 170 using (var xmlReader = new JsonXmlReader(JsonReader.ParseString(json), new JsonXmlReaderOptions { NamespaceUri = "JsonXmlReaderSimpleTest", RootName = "Data", NodesPrefix = "json", CaseTransform = JsonXmlCaseTransform.UcFirst, ArrayItemName = "Item" })) { |
171 xmlWriter.WriteNode(xmlReader, false); | 171 xmlWriter.WriteNode(xmlReader, false); |
172 } | 172 } |
173 Console.WriteLine(); | 173 Console.WriteLine(); |
174 } | 174 } |
175 | 175 |